A tightly fitted piston can slide along the inner wall of a long cylindrical pipe. With the piston at the lower end of the pipe, the lower end of the pipe is dipped into a large tank, filled with water. Now the piston is pulled up with the help of the rod attached to it. water rises in the pipe along with the piston. Why? To what maximum height water can be raised in the pipe using this method? What will be the answer to your question if water is replaced with mercuty? Atmosphere pressure is `P_("atm")=1.01xx10^(5)Pa`.
